Today, the Speaker of the Verkhovna Rada of Ukraine, Ruslan Stefanchuk, made an important visit to the United States of America, where he discussed current security and defense issues with Ms. Nancy Pelosi, Speaker of the US House of Representatives.
The Speaker of the Verkhovna Rada of Ukraine, Ruslan Stefanchuk, met with the Honorary Speaker of the US House of Representatives, Nancy Pelosi, during his working visit to the United States. The Speaker of the Verkhovna Rada wrote about this on Facebook.

During the meeting, Stefanchuk emphasized that the adoption of the US aid package was of extremely significant historical significance for our country and for the defense of Ukraine from Russian aggression, for the protection of our people.
The main issue discussed was the security situation in Ukraine. (…) He called for facilitating permission for Ukraine to strike Russian military facilities on the territory of the Russian Federation with allied weapons.
According to him, after the latest Russian attack and the shelling of a children's hospital in the capital, Putin demonstrated to the world that there are no red lines for him.
In addition, the Speaker of the Verkhovna Rada thanked Nancy Pelosi for her personal leadership in supporting Ukraine and the United States for its unprecedented assistance to Ukraine from the first days of the full-scale invasion.
